Calculus 3 FAQ

What topics are covered in Calculus III?

Calculus III typically covers multivariable calculus including three-dimensional space, vectors, partial derivatives, multiple integrals, and vector calculus including topics like line and surface integrals, and the theorems of Green, Stokes, and Gauss.

How does one visualize three-dimensional graphs in Calculus III?

Visualizing three-dimensional graphs in Calculus III can be done using computer software like GeoGebra or MATLAB, by drawing level curves and surfaces on paper, or by constructing physical models. Understanding the axes and how the z-dimension adds depth is crucial.

Can Calculus III help me understand physics better?

Absolutely, Calculus III is essential for understanding the mathematical framework behind many physical theories, especially those involving three-dimensional motion, electromagnetic fields, and fluid dynamics where vector calculus is utilized.

What is the best way to study for a Calculus III exam?

Studying for a Calculus III exam involves reviewing lecture notes, practicing problems from the textbook, seeking help from tutors or study groups, using online resources for additional practice, and ensuring a strong grasp of foundational concepts like vectors and differentiation.

Are there any online resources for Calculus III tutoring?

Yes, there are numerous online resources for Calculus III tutoring, including Khan Academy, MIT OpenCourseWare, Paul's Online Math Notes, Coursera, and private tutoring services that offer personalized help and practice problems.

About Hilltop Lakes, TX And It’s Education Institutions

Hilltop Lakes, Texas, a hidden gem within the Lone Star State, boasts a peaceful, tight-knit community rich in amenities and natural beauty. Established in the mid-20th century, this picturesque community flourished around its captivating landscapes, characterized by rolling hills, five pristine lakes, and an abundance of wildlife. Landmarks such as the 18-hole golf course, the Texas-shaped swimming pool, and the Hilltop Lakes Airport distinguish the area as a unique leisure destination. While the area maintains a cozy, small-town feeling, its history dates back to 1962 when it was developed as a vacation-retreat and residential area. Despite its small size, Hilltop Lakes plays a significant role in maintaining the essence of Texas' rural charm, offering residents a respite from the hustle of city life.

While Hilltop Lakes may be modest in scale and free from the hustle of larger education institutions, it maintains a commitment to quality education through local schools and educational resources. Children residing in Hilltop Lakes attend schools in the nearby Leon Independent School District (ISD), which serves the community with dedication to preparing students for a promising future. Although there may not be a diverse list of top ranked private and public K-12 schools directly within Hilltop Lakes, the surrounding areas provide accessible education facilities, supported by community effort and resources aimed at enhancing learning opportunities for young residents. Furthermore, Leon ISD takes pride in fostering environments where students are encouraged to achieve their full potential, with a focus on both academic and personal growth.

When it comes to higher education, Hilltop Lakes itself is not home to universities, but the proximity to larger cities means that residents have access to a variety of post-secondary options within a reasonable commuting distance. Students aspiring to pursue higher education can look to the neighboring cities and towns where numerous colleges and universities present a broad spectrum of programs and courses. Currently, Hilltop Lakes enjoys a quiet, yet vibrant atmosphere supported by roughly 1,000 residents who cherish the sense of community and the slower pace of rural life. Despite its small population, Hilltop Lakes represents a slice of Texan identity, where history is preserved, education is valued, and every landmark tells a story.

About Calculus 3 & Calculus 3 Tutoring

Calculus III, often termed Multivariable Calculus or Multivariate Calculus, extends the concepts of limits, derivatives, and integrals to functions of multiple variables. Where Calculus I focuses on functions of a single variable and Calculus II explores techniques for integration, sequences, and series, Calculus III broadens this study to higher dimensions, which requires a solid understanding of three-dimensional space and vectors.

In Calculus III, the understanding of curves and surfaces in three-dimensional space is crucial. This level of calculus uses the same principles as previous calculus courses, but adds the complexity of extra dimensions. For instance, partial derivatives are an extension of the derivative concept, examining the rate of change of a function with respect to one variable while holding others constant.

Types of Calculus III focus on several key concepts like partial derivatives, multiple integrals (double and triple integrals), vector calculus, and theorems that bind them together such as Green's Theorem, Stokes' Theorem, and the Divergence Theorem. Vector calculus is a substantial part of this course since it merges the geometry of vectors with the analysis of multivariate functions.

Related entities to Calculus III are Linear Algebra, Differential Equations, and Physics, particularly mechanics and electromagnetism. These subjects often utilize the mathematical tools developed in Calculus III.

Tutoring someone in Calculus III who struggles with the subject involves the best approach of:

  1. Establishing a strong foundation in prerequisite materials, such as Calculus I and II concepts, along with a firm grasp of vector manipulation.
  2. Illustrating the geometric interpretations of multivariable functions, curves, and surfaces to enhance comprehension.
  3. Practicing incremental problem-solving, starting with simpler problems to build confidence and moving gradually to more complex scenarios.
  4. Using visual aids, like graphs and animations, to demonstrate three-dimensional concepts.
  5. Encouraging the development of a strong problem-solving toolkit, including the use of software for computation and visualization when appropriate.
  6. Personalizing the learning experience, allowing the student to explore applications and examples relevant to their interests and field of study.

The most common concepts in Calculus III include vector functions, partial derivatives, the gradient, divergence, curl, and various methods of integration over curves, surfaces, and volumes. The most difficult concepts often revolve around the application and understanding of the major theorems, such as Stokes' or Divergence Theorem, because they require a strong conceptual and visual understanding of complex three-dimensional space.

To succeed in Calculus III, students need to develop a strong visualization skill set and be adept at abstract thinking to thoroughly understand the implications of changes in multiple dimensions. Practice and exposure to a variety of problems, alongside patient and supportive tutoring, can substantially aid in mastering this advanced level of calculus.
